Top Destinations for English-Taught Programs
- Germany: Known for its tuition-free public universities, Germany is an excellent choice for Nepalese students. Popular fields include engineering, IT, and business.
- Netherlands: With over 2,000 English-taught degrees available, the Netherlands is a hub for international education, especially at the master's level.
- Finland: Offering more than 400 English-taught courses, Finland provides high-quality education in a technologically advanced environment.
- Sweden: Swedish universities offer numerous English-language programs, particularly in areas like sustainability and innovation.
- Denmark: Known for its high-quality education and diverse English-taught programs, Denmark is an attractive destination for Nepalese students.

Admission Requirements
Nepalese students typically need to provide:
- Completed higher secondary education (10+2) certificates
- Proof of English proficiency (IELTS, TOEFL, or equivalent)
- Academic transcripts
- Statement of Purpose
- Letters of recommendation
Scholarships and Funding
Nepalese students can apply for several scholarship opportunities:
- Erasmus Mundus Joint Master Degrees
- Country-specific scholarships (e.g., DAAD for Germany)
- University-specific scholarships
